Matthew Elijah Bowes was born in 1881 in Elsing, Mitford & Launditch, Norfolk, England, the child of William Bowes And Susannah Skipper. In 1881, Matthew Elijah Bowes resided in Elsing, Mitford & Launditch, Norfolk, England. In 1891, Matthew Elijah Bowes resided in Elsing, Mitford & Launditch, Norfolk, England. Matthew Elijah Bowes passed away in 1918 in Warwickshire, England.
